xlsx读取第一列数据
时间: 2023-09-20 20:11:10 浏览: 49
可以使用Python中的pandas库来读取xlsx文件中的第一列数据。实现代码如下:
```
import pandas as pd
data = pd.read_excel('your_file.xlsx', usecols=[0])
first_column = data.iloc[:,0]
print(first_column)
```
其中,'your_file.xlsx'是你要读取的文件名,usecols=[0]表示读取第一列数据,即A列。最后将第一列数据存储在first_column变量中。
相关问题
读取xlsx文件的第一列数据
好的,您可以使用Python中的pandas库来读取xlsx文件并获取第一列数据。以下是示例代码:
```python
import pandas as pd
# 读取xlsx文件
df = pd.read_excel('file.xlsx')
# 获取第一列数据
first_column = df.iloc[:, 0]
# 输出第一列数据
print(first_column)
```
其中,`file.xlsx`是您要读取的xlsx文件名,`iloc`函数可以用来获取指定行列的数据。上述代码中,`df.iloc[:, 0]`表示获取所有行的第0列数据,即第一列数据。
qtxlsx 读取excel所用列
qtxlsx 是一个用于读取 Excel 文件的 Python 库。要读取 Excel 文件中的特定列,可以按照以下步骤进行操作:
首先,需要使用 qtxlsx 库导入 Excel 文件。可以使用 `open_workbook` 函数来打开文件并获取一个工作簿对象。
然后,可以通过工作簿对象获取工作表对象。可以使用 `sheet_by_index` 函数并传入相应的索引来获取工作表。也可以使用 `sheet_by_name` 函数并传入相应的名称来获取工作表。
接下来,可以使用工作表对象的 `row_values` 函数来获取指定行的数据。可以传入相应的行索引来获取该行的内容。
最后,可以使用从特定行获取的数据来提取所需要的列数据。可以使用列表切片操作来选择所需的列。例如,若要获取第二列的数据,可以使用 `data[1]` 来获取。
以下是一个示例代码来读取 Excel 文件的指定列数据:
```python
import qtxlsx
# 打开 Excel 文件
workbook = qtxlsx.open_workbook('example.xlsx')
# 获取第一个工作表
sheet = workbook.sheet_by_index(0)
# 读取第一列数据
column_data = sheet.col_values(0)
# 打印第一列数据
print(column_data)
```
通过以上步骤,就可以使用 qtxlsx 读取 Excel 文件的特定列数据。注意,以上代码仅是一个示例,实际使用时可能需要根据具体情况进行适当修改。